David Shepro

Suggest Changes
Learn More
Endothelial cells are the primary physical barrier between blood and tissue in microvessels. The other capillary and post-capillary venule wall cell is the pericyte. The literature on the biology of(More)
Endothelial and mesothelial cells are mesodermally derived simple squamous epithelial cells. A controversy concerning the ontogenetic origin of neoplasms derived from these cell types, commonly cited(More)